这是什么颜色表? cmap = mglearn.cm3
问题描述:
我尝试运行下面的代码,但它在识别mglearn彩色贴图时出现以下错误。这是什么颜色表? cmap = mglearn.cm3
GRR = pd.scatter_matrix(....,CMAP = mglearn.cm3)
ErrorName:名称 'mglearn' 没有定义
我要补充PD是阿纳康达熊猫包导入为PD但无法识别颜色图mglearn.cm3
有什么建议吗?
答
涉及书中的代码 - 介绍机器学习与Python
- 在代码的书(笔记本电脑等)有一个名为包文件夹顶部 - mglearn。它包含,作为其拳头.py文件 - init .py。
- 因此,它允许我在我的Spyder 3.5编辑器中简单地将文件夹 - mglearn复制/粘贴到我的 C:\ Users \ Ernesto \ Anaconda3文件夹中,然后键入 - import mglearn。
-
然后行:
grr = pd.scatter_matrix(iris_dataframe, c=y_train, figsize=(15, 15), marker='o', hist_kwds={'bins': 20}, s=60, alpha=0.8, cmap=mglearn.cm3)
打印的scatter_matrix正如书中。
Python告诉你,你的代码没有在任何地方定义“mglearn”。这听起来像你正在尝试使用一个名为“mglearn”的模块而不导入它。 – RJHunter
如果'mglearn.cm3'是一个文件,它应该用引号括起来。 – rassar
我明白了。它可以使用pip进行安装 – user3252955